About Median Household Income
Chase County, Nebraska has a median household income of $68,173, ranking #1,326 of 3,222 counties nationwide — 9.3% below the national value of $75,149. Within Nebraska, it ranks #51 of 93. This places it in the 59th percentile nationally.
The median annual income for all households, including wages, investments, and government transfers. Source: U.S. Census Bureau, American Community Survey 2024 5-Year Estimates.
